Scammers (and legitimate people) use Western Union because it doesn't have Paypal's feature of "if you're not happy, we'll refund the money." So, you get a bad money order. You deposit it and think you have money. You use Western Union to send off the left-overs to the scammer and ship your book. A few days later, the bank discovers you deposited a fraudulent money order and removes the deposited amount from your account. You can't "repeal" the Western Union transaction and you can't call back your package. Scammer has book and money, and you have squat.

Wester Union is used as a scam by SELLERS. You, as the victim buyer, wires them money....and they send you squat. Now you have to go to the police.
